Disability shower installation services involve designing and setting up accessible shower areas tailored to individual mobility needs. These installations often include features such as low-threshold or curbless entryways, grab bars, seating options, and non-slip flooring to enhance safety and independence. Service providers work with property owners to modify existing bathrooms or install new accessible showers that comply with specific ergonomic and safety standards, making daily routines more manageable for individuals with mobility challenges.

This service addresses common problems associated with traditional showers, such as difficulty stepping over high thresholds, risk of slips and falls, and limited accessibility for users with disabilities or aging-related mobility issues. By upgrading or installing accessible shower systems, property owners can reduce safety hazards and improve usability, fostering greater independence and comfort. These modifications are especially beneficial for individuals recovering from injuries, seniors, or those with chronic conditions that affect mobility.

Properties that typically utilize disability shower installation services include residential homes, assisted living facilities, and healthcare establishments. In residential settings, homeowners seeking to accommodate aging family members or individuals with disabilities often opt for these upgrades. In multifamily complexes or senior living communities, accessible showers are integrated into unit renovations or new constructions to ensure compliance with accessibility standards and to support residents’ needs.

Installation Costs - The cost for installing a disability shower typically ranges from $1,500 to $4,000, depending on the complexity of the project and materials used. Basic installations in areas like Woodbridge, CT, tend to be on the lower end of this spectrum. More customized or accessible features may increase the overall expense.

Material Expenses - The price of shower materials varies widely, with standard accessible shower bases costing around $300 to $800. High-end, slip-resistant, or specialized materials can push costs above $1,000. Local pros can help select materials that fit both needs and budget.

Additional Features - Installing grab bars, seating, or non-slip flooring can add $200 to $1,000 or more to the total cost. These features are often customized to meet specific accessibility requirements and may influence the overall project budget.

Labor Charges - Labor for disability shower installation generally ranges from $500 to $2,500, depending on the project's scope and local rates. More complex modifications or structural changes can increase labor costs significantly. Contact local service providers for detailed estimates tailored to specific need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When evaluating local professionals for disability shower installation services, it is important to consider their experience with similar projects. Homeowners should look for contractors who have a proven track record in accessible bathroom modifications, including installing features like grab bars, walk-in showers, and non-slip surfaces. Clear communication about their previous work can provide insight into their familiarity with disability-friendly designs and their ability to meet specific accessibility needs.

Written expectations are a key aspect of a successful project. Homeowners are encouraged to seek out professionals who provide detailed descriptions of their services, including the scope of work, materials used, and estimated timelines. Transparent documentation helps ensure that both parties share a mutual understanding of the project’s requirements, reducing the potential for misunderstandings or unmet expectations during the installation process.

Reputable references and strong communication are essential when choosing a local service provider. Homeowners should inquire about references from past clients who had similar accessibility upgrades, as these can offer valuable insights into the contractor’s reliability and quality of work. Additionally, responsive and clear communication from the pros can facilitate smoother project coordination, answer questions promptly, and help ensure that the installation aligns with the homeowner’s specific needs and preferences.
